aeperezt
Arrived on 2013-08-08.
Ranked 61 out of 60176 ranked users (top 0.11%).
View user as: JSON, RSS, RDF
received on 2023-06-02
received on 2023-05-31
received on 2022-12-22
received on 2022-08-05
received on 2022-05-13
received on 2021-08-06
received on 2021-06-11
received on 2021-05-21
received on 2021-04-28
This is only the last 10 entries. Click here to see all of them.
aeperezt has earned 132 badges (22.3% of total).